Run the golf course during Chevy Chase 5K in Wheeling

For the first time, the Wheeling Park District is making Traditions at Chevy Chase Golf Course available to runners for the Chevy Chase 5K, which will take place at 9 a.m. Sunday, Nov. 10.

This new event is suitable for runners of all ages and abilities. Participants step off at 5- to 10-second intervals in a time-trial start that allows for a safe race.

The preregistration fee is $25; day-of registration is $30. Register online at www.chevychase5k.com or in person at the Community Recreation Center, 333 W. Dundee Road, in Wheeling. Those who register in advance may pick up race packets at Chevy Chase Country Club, 1000 N. Milwaukee Ave., from noon-6 p.m. Friday, Nov. 8, or 10 a.m.-5 p.m. Saturday, Nov. 9.

Day-of registration and check-in starts at 7:30 a.m. Sunday, Nov. 10.

The Chevy Chase 5K meanders through the scenic landscape on the cart paths that follow the tree-lined fairways of Traditions at Chevy Chase Golf Course. Water is provided along the course and time splits are given at each mile. A celebration takes place after the race.

All participants receive a race shirt. Prizes are awarded to the top overall male and female finishers, as well as the male and female winners in each of the 14 age categories. All participants in the Children's Race receive a prize. Results will be available after the race at www.chevychase5k.com and www.racetime.info.
